Cation exchange capacity is defined as a soil’s total quantity of negative surface charges. It is measured commonly in commercial soil testing labs by summing cations (positively charged ions that are attracted to the negative surface charges in soil). Exchangeable cations include base cations, calcium (Ca 2+ ), magnesium (Mg 2+ ), potassium (K + ) and sodium (Na + ), as well as acid cations such as hydrogen (H + ), aluminum (Al 3+ ) and ammonium (NHcuatro + ).

(Ca 2+ + Mg 2+ + K + + Na + ) + (H + + Al 3+ + NH4 + )
